MB A 170 290 01 82 (Mercedes, Smart)

EPC / Mercedes / MB A 170 290 01 82
PAD
MB A 170 290 01 82 | MB A1702900182 | MB 1702900182
Part Price Price Availability Seller
PAD
VAG A 170 290 01 82 Get price in stock
Get price
in stock
PARTSinn